The Automation & Instrument Engineer is responsible for managing automation projects from concept development through to final handover, while ensuring the reliability and availability of existing automation and instrumentation systems within factory operations. The role also provides technical support and troubleshooting for automation equipment and drives improvement and digitalisation initiatives to enhance productivity, quality, safety, equipment reliability, and operational efficiency.
Job Responsibilities
1. Automation Project Management
- Plan, coordinate, and manage automation projects from concept development, design, procurement, installation, testing, commissioning, and final handover.
- Develop technical specifications, User Requirement Specifications (URS), project scope, budget, and implementation schedules.
- Evaluate automation proposals, technologies, system integrators, and suppliers based on technical capability, cost, reliability, safety, and operational requirements.
- Coordinate with Production, Engineering, Quality, Safety, IT, Supply Chain, and other relevant departments during project implementation.
- Monitor project progress, cost, quality, and schedule to ensure projects are completed according to agreed requirements.
- Manage Factory Acceptance Test (FAT), Site Acceptance Test (SAT), commissioning, performance verification, and project documentation.
- Ensure proper knowledge transfer and training are provided to users and maintenance personnel before project handover.
2. Maintenance of Existing Automation & Instrumentation Facilities
- Maintain the reliability and availability of existing automation and instrumentation systems used in factory operations.
- Provide technical support and troubleshooting for PLC, HMI, SCADA, DCS, sensors, transmitters, control systems, servo systems, variable frequency drives, communication networks, and related automation equipment.
- Analyse automation and instrumentation breakdowns, identify root causes, and implement corrective and preventive actions to avoid recurrence.
- Establish and improve preventive maintenance programs for automation and instrumentation equipment.
- Monitor equipment condition, system performance, obsolescence, and spare-part availability to minimise production interruption.
- Coordinate with equipment manufacturers, system integrators, and service providers for specialised troubleshooting and maintenance activities.
- Maintain proper backup, revision control, and recovery procedures for PLC programs, HMI applications, system configurations, and other automation software.
- Identify opportunities to improve productivity, quality, safety, manpower utilisation, equipment reliability, and operational efficiency through automation.
- Develop and implement automation improvement projects for existing production and utility facilities.
- Study manual and repetitive processes and propose suitable automation solutions with consideration of technical feasibility, investment cost, ROI, and operational benefits.
- Improve existing control systems, machine sequences, interlocks, alarms, monitoring systems, and data collection capabilities.
- Support integration of production equipment and automation systems with digital platforms, databases, dashboards, or manufacturing information systems where applicable.
- Promote standardisation of automation hardware, software, programming practices, and control philosophy across the factory.
- Monitor the performance and benefits of completed automation improvements and recommend further optimisation where necessary.
